Podcast Description
I love three things in life: football, food and film. I am Gaetano Ghiura, an Italian writer-director-producer, and I know from personal experience how difficult it is to navigate the audiovisual industry. Therefore here, in this podcast, we will talk with industry professionals to explore their careers and learn from their struggles and experiences, to understand how they, somehow, made it.

In this episode, Gaetano sits down with Jed Shepherd – co-writer and producer of HOST (2020), one of the highest-rated horror films ever made, and collaborator of Blumhouse, Netflix, and Sam Raimi.
Jed talks about growing up obsessed with horror in South London, spending years in finance while writing scripts on the side, and how making HOST became the moment that changed everything.
They also get into what it really means to call yourself a filmmaker, why you can’t afford to be just one thing in this industry, and the writing system Jed swears by – 3 hours every morning, then stop, no matter what.
A conversation about horror, obsession, and reinvention.
